Wessel Nijman Beats Rob Cross To Win 2026 Slovak Darts Open

Wessel Nijman beat Rob Cross to win the 2026 Slovak Darts Open in Bratislava on Sunday, sealing the title at the inaugural PDC European Tour event in Slovakia.

The Dutchman defeated Cross in the final at the Incheba Expo, completing a statement run through Finals Day and adding another significant result to his fast-rising 2026 campaign. The result followed Nijman’s 8-3 win over Cross in the Slovak Darts Open final, which closed the event’s first visit to Slovakia.

The tournament ran from June 19-21 and carried added importance because it marked the first PDC European Tour stop staged in Slovakia. Cross had reached the final after coming through the same side of the draw, but Nijman finished the weekend as the player lifting the trophy, as reported in The Sun’s live results coverage.

Nijman lands another marker on the European Tour

For Nijman, this is the kind of result that keeps sharpening the conversation around his place among the sport’s most dangerous emerging title threats.

The win also gives the Slovak Darts Open an emphatic first champion. With Michael van Gerwen and other seeded names beaten earlier in the event, the final became a direct test of whether Nijman could turn opportunity into silverware against an established former world champion.

He did exactly that. Cross leaves Bratislava with another deep European Tour run, but Nijman’s title is the result that will shape the event’s first history.
